Overview of Protestant Churches
Protestant Churches are Christian churches that originated from the 16th century Reformation movement. The movement began in Europe and spread to other parts of the world, including the United Kingdom. Protestantism emphasizes the individual's relationship with God through faith and the authority of the Bible. Protestant Churches offer services, events, and activities for members of the church community to come together, worship, and grow spiritually.
History of Protestantism and its beliefs
Protestantism emerged in the 16th century as a response to perceived corruption and excesses in the Roman Catholic Church, which led to the split from the Catholic Church. Protestantism emphasized the role of faith and the Bible as the source of religious authority. Protestants also rejected the Catholic doctrine of transubstantiation, the idea that the bread and wine used in communion become the actual body and blood of Christ. The various Protestant denominations have different interpretations of the Bible, but they all share the common belief in salvation through faith in Jesus Christ.
Types of Protestant Churches and their differences
There are many different types of Protestant Churches, including Baptist, Methodist, Presbyterian, Anglican, and Pentecostal churches. Each denomination has its own unique beliefs, practices, and traditions. For example, Baptist churches practice adult baptism by immersion, while Methodist churches practice infant baptism by sprinkling. Presbyterian churches are governed by a system of elders, while Anglican churches are part of a hierarchical structure led by bishops. Pentecostal churches emphasize the spiritual gifts of speaking in tongues and prophecy.
Importance of religion and faith in Protestantism
Religion and faith are central to Protestantism, which emphasizes the importance of a personal relationship with God through faith in Jesus Christ. Protestants believe that salvation comes through faith and not through good works or sacraments. Protestants also emphasize the authority of the Bible, which they believe is the inspired word of God and the source of all religious truth.
